In a small saucepan, bring 1 cup of water to a boil. Add the 1/2 cup of rolled oats and a pinch of salt. Reduce heat to a simmer, cover, and cook for about 5-7 minutes, or until oats are tender and have absorbed most of the water. Stir occasionally.
While the oats are cooking, heat 1 tbsp of olive oil in a skillet over medium heat. Add a handful of cherry tomatoes and sauté for about 3-4 minutes, until they start to blister.
Add 1 cup of fresh spinach to the skillet with the tomatoes. Season with salt and pepper to taste. Sauté until the spinach is wilted, about 2 minutes. Transfer the sautéed spinach and tomatoes to a plate and keep warm.
In the same skillet, add the remaining 1 tbsp of olive oil and heat over medium heat. Crack the two eggs into the skillet and fry until the whites are set but the yolks are still runny, about 3-4 minutes. Season with salt and pepper.
Once the oats are cooked, spoon them into a serving bowl. Top with the sautéed spinach and tomatoes.
Place the fried eggs on top of the oats and vegetables. Sprinkle with 1 tbsp of grated Parmesan cheese.
Serve immediately, and enjoy your hearty and healthy breakfast!
